-
Notifications
You must be signed in to change notification settings - Fork 2k
[KFLUXDP-711] Add prow-failure-analysis to the appstudio-e2etests in infra-deployments tests #73158
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Conversation
|
/pj-rehearse |
|
@calebevans: now processing your pj-rehearse request. Please allow up to 10 minutes for jobs to trigger or cancel. |
|
/pj-rehearse |
|
@calebevans: now processing your pj-rehearse request. Please allow up to 10 minutes for jobs to trigger or cancel. |
|
/pj-rehearse |
|
@calebevans: now processing your pj-rehearse request. Please allow up to 10 minutes for jobs to trigger or cancel. |
|
/pj-rehearse |
|
@calebevans: now processing your pj-rehearse request. Please allow up to 10 minutes for jobs to trigger or cancel. |
|
/pj-rehearse |
|
@calebevans: now processing your pj-rehearse request. Please allow up to 10 minutes for jobs to trigger or cancel. |
|
/pj-rehearse |
|
@calebevans: now processing your pj-rehearse request. Please allow up to 10 minutes for jobs to trigger or cancel. |
🤖 Pipeline Failure AnalysisCategory: Unknown RCA generation failed: litellm.BadRequestError: LLM Provider NOT provided. Pass in the LLM provider you are trying to call. You passed model=google/gemini-2.5-flash-lite 📋 Technical DetailsUnable to generate detailed analysis. 🔍 Evidenceappstudio-e2e-tests/redhat-appstudio-e2eCategory: Analysis powered by prow-failure-analysis | Build: |
|
@calebevans Lets say we have multiple prow errors in the PR... We will see multiple bot responses errors? If yes, we should make the bot only keep the last job failure |
@flacatus If a failure occurs, it will leave a comment. If the user re-tests and it fails again, a new comment will be made with a completely new analysis where only the new failure is taken into consideration. I'm not sure that we should be deleting old comments, just so there can be a running history of failures in a PR with reasons for why it failed. |
|
/pj-rehearse |
|
@calebevans: now processing your pj-rehearse request. Please allow up to 10 minutes for jobs to trigger or cancel. |
|
[REHEARSALNOTIFIER]
Interacting with pj-rehearseComment: Once you are satisfied with the results of the rehearsals, comment: |
🤖 Pipeline Failure AnalysisCategory: Infrastructure The pipeline failed due to a GitLab API request timeout during the e2e test execution, preventing the creation of necessary build artifacts. 📋 Technical DetailsImmediate CauseA GitLab API request timed out with a 408 Request Timeout error. This prevented the Contributing FactorsThe test ImpactThe GitLab API timeout directly blocked the completion of a core e2e test scenario, preventing the validation of build service functionality with renovate and multi-component setups. This failure prevented the pipeline from proceeding with further validation or deployment steps. 🔍 Evidenceappstudio-e2e-tests/redhat-appstudio-e2eCategory: Analysis powered by prow-failure-analysis | Build: |
|
/pj-rehearse |
|
@calebevans: now processing your pj-rehearse request. Please allow up to 10 minutes for jobs to trigger or cancel. |
|
/pj-rehearse skip |
|
@calebevans: now processing your pj-rehearse request. Please allow up to 10 minutes for jobs to trigger or cancel. |
|
[APPROVALNOTIFIER] This PR is APPROVED This pull-request has been approved by: calebevans, psturc The full list of commands accepted by this bot can be found here. The pull request process is described here DetailsNeeds approval from an approver in each of these files:
Approvers can indicate their approval by writing |
|
/pj-rehearse abort |
|
@calebevans: now processing your pj-rehearse request. Please allow up to 10 minutes for jobs to trigger or cancel. |
🤖 Pipeline Failure AnalysisCategory: Test The E2E tests failed due to a violation of enterprise contract policies, specifically reporting "No test data found" during the verification step. 📋 Technical DetailsImmediate CauseThe Contributing FactorsNone identified in the provided data. ImpactThis failure prevented the successful completion of the E2E test suite, indicating a potential issue with test data setup or policy enforcement within the test environment. 🔍 Evidenceappstudio-e2e-tests/redhat-appstudio-e2eCategory: Analysis powered by prow-failure-analysis | Build: |
5502c3f
into
openshift:master
No description provided.